ITF23019 Parallell og distribuert programmering (Vår 2025)
Fakta om emnet
- Studiepoeng:
- 10
- Ansvarlig avdeling:
- Fakultet for informasjonsteknologi, ingeniørfag og økonomi
- Studiested:
- Halden
- Emneansvarlig:
- Thi Thuy Nga Dinh
- Undervisningsspråk:
- Norsk eller engelsk
- Varighet:
- ½ år
Emnet er tilknyttet følgende studieprogram
Obligatorisk emne i bachelorstudiet i informatikk - design og utvikling av IT-systemer med fordypning i programmering
Valgfritt emne for øvrige.
Absolutte forkunnskaper
ITF10219 Programmering 1 og ITF10619 Programmering 2
Anbefalte forkunnskaper
ITF20006 Algoritmer og datastrukturer
Undervisningssemester
4. og 6. semester (vår).
Studentens læringsutbytte etter bestått emne
Kunnskap
Studenten
-
forstår grunnleggende prinsipper med programmering mot flere kjerner
-
forstår grunnleggende prinsipper med programmering mot ulike typer prosessorer
-
har kjennskap til ulike teknikker for parallell prosessering
-
har kjennskap til ulike typer parallelle algoritmer og deres ytelse
-
har kjennskap til distribuert prosessering som tungregning og Cloud Computing
Ferdigheter
Studenten kan
-
skrive programmer med parallell prosessering
-
skrive programmer med distribuert prosessering
Generell kompetanse
Studenten kan
-
effektiv utnyttelse av moderne maskinvare
-
utnytte mulighetene med distribuerte systemer
Innhold
Grunnleggende prinsipper for parallellisering
Ulike former for oppdeling av prosessering
Kommunikasjons- og synkroniseringsmekanismer
Undervisnings- og læringsformer
Prosjektarbeid, forelesninger og laboratorieveiledning.
Arbeidsomfang
Ca 250 timer.
Arbeidskrav - vilkår for å avlegge eksamen
Inntil 14 obligatoriske oppgaver leveres i løpet av semesteret
Minst 10 innleveringer må være godkjent før studenten kan fremstille seg til eksamen.
Eksamen
4-timers individuell skriftlig eksamen med fokus på teori.
Ingen hjelpemidler tillatt.
Det gis individuell karakter, karakterskala A - F.
Sensorordning
Ekstern og intern sensor, eller to interne sensorer, skal medvirke.
Vilkår for ny/utsatt eksamen
Ny og utsatt eksamen gjennomføres samtidig med neste ordinære eksamen. Instituttledelsen kan likevel beslutte å arrangere utsatt eksamen i påfølgende semester for studenter med gyldig fravær ved ordinær eksamen.
Evaluering av emnet
Dette emnet evalueres på følgende måte:
Sluttsemesterevaluering (obligatorisk)
Den emneansvarlige lager en oppsummering på bakgrunn av studentenes tilbakemeldinger og sine egne erfaringer med emnet. Oppsummeringen behandles av programutvalget ved institutt for informasjonsteknologi og kommunikasjon.
Litteratur
Gjeldende litteraturliste for 2024 Vår finner du i Leganto